1

この選択で MS-SQL がエラーをスローしないのはなぜですか? #aa テーブルには Document_ID フィールドがありません。

 CREATE TABLE docs
 (
  Document_ID uniqueidentifier
 )

 SELECT 0x00 Document_XX
 INTO #aa


 SELECT * 
 FROM docs
 WHERE Document_ID IN (SELECT Document_ID FROM #aa)
4

1 に答える 1

1

Document_IDinSELECT Document_ID FROM #aaは単にに解決されますdocs.Document_ID

それは同じだろう

SELECT * 
FROM docs d
WHERE Document_ID IN (SELECT d.Document_ID FROM #aa)
于 2013-11-12T11:28:56.313 に答える